Fayetteville State University has a test-optional policy, allowing students to apply without standardized test scores. For those who submit scores, the average SAT is 950, with a 25th percentile of 890 and a 75th percentile of 1030. The average ACT score is 19, with a 25th percentile of 15 and a 75th percentile of 23. International students should aim for a minimum TOEFL score of 65, with an average score of 75, and a minimum IELTS score of 6.0, with an average of 6.5. The average weighted GPA is 3.75, while the unweighted average GPA is 3.375.

More DetailsFayetteville State University does not allow superscoring in their admissions process. Superscoring means that a college considers only the highest scores from multiple test dates rather than the total from a single date, potentially benefiting applicants who improve over time. This policy indicates that applicants should focus on achieving their best possible scores on individual test dates rather than relying on compiled scores.
